Clinical Scope of In-Home Musculoskeletal Rehabilitation

Comprehensive Diagnostic Tracks Spanning Spinal and Peripheral Joints

Our orthopaedic in-home service encompasses a comprehensive clinical spectrum: 1. Spinal Pathologies & Radicular Syndromes: Lumbar disc protrusions and herniations, sciatic neuropathy, cervical disc lesions, cervical facet joint lock, lumbar canal stenosis, and degenerative spondylolisthesis. 2. Major Joint Osteoarthritis: Advanced knee osteoarthritis with range of motion restrictions, degenerative hip arthritis, and sacroiliac joint dysfunction. 3. Shoulder Complex Impairments: Adhesive capsulitis (frozen shoulder) across all stages, subacromial impingement syndrome, and rotator cuff tendinopathy or partial tears. 4. Soft Tissue & Tendon Disorders: Plantar fasciitis, Achilles tendinopathy, lateral epicondylalgia (tennis elbow), and persistent myofascial pain trigger points.

Objective Orthopaedic Clinical Evaluation Protocol

A Thorough 60-Minute Biomechanical Intake Isolating Primary Pain Drivers

Every musculoskeletal consultation commences with an objective clinical intake: - Active and Passive Range of Motion (Goniometric Audit): Quantitative measurement of joint range of motion using clinical goniometers to document mechanical movement restrictions and end-feel characteristics (capsular, muscular, or bony block). - Provocative Neurological & Dural Tension Testing: Conducting the Straight Leg Raise (SLR), Spurling's test, and Slump test to identify nerve root compression or neuromeningeal irritation. - Manual Muscle Strength Grading (Oxford Scale): Evaluating agonist-antagonist strength ratios and isolating inhibited muscular stabilizers across the kinetic chain. - Biomechanical & Postural Assessment: Examining spinal curvature, pelvic tilt, and weight-bearing symmetry during standing, sitting, and gait cycles.

  • Baseline vitals screening and cardiovascular risk stratification
  • Digital goniometric active/passive range-of-motion measurement
  • Standardized manual muscle testing (Oxford Scale 0-5)
  • Neurodynamic dural tension tests (SLR, Slump, Spurling)
  • Postural alignment, pelvic symmetry, and gait biomechanics audit

Advanced In-Home Manual Therapy and Joint Mobilization

Restoring Arthrokinematic Glides and Inhibiting Peripheral Nociceptive Pain

Our visiting clinicians execute specialized manual therapy interventions within your home: - Maitland Graded Joint Mobilizations (Grades I-IV): Utilizing gentle, rhythmic oscillatory movements to stimulate articular mechanoreceptors, suppress pain perception, and restore physiological joint capsule accessory glides. - McKenzie Method of Mechanical Diagnosis and Therapy (MDT): Identifying directional preferences to encourage disc nuclear centralization and rapidly reduce peripheral radicular referral along the extremity. - Myofascial Trigger Point Deactivation: Applying targeted ischemic compression and transverse friction massage to eliminate hyperirritable taut bands in the lumbar, scapular, and gluteal musculature.

Neuromuscular Stabilization and Deep Core Retraining

Constructing an Anatomic Muscular Brace Protecting the Spine and Joints

While manual therapy temporarily modulates pain, progressive therapeutic strengthening is essential to achieve lasting functional recovery: - Transversus Abdominis and Lumbar Multifidus Activation: Coaching patients in deep abdominal drawing-in maneuvers to stabilize the lumbar spine during movement without breath holding. - Gluteal Muscle Activation & Pelvic Stability: Strengthening the gluteus medius and maximus to correct dynamic knee valgus and minimize compressive joint loads during ambulation. - Progressive Elastic Band Loading: Gradually introducing multi-directional resistance using calibrated Therabands to restore functional muscular endurance and joint dynamic stabilization.

Neurodynamic Mobilization and Peripheral Nerve Gliding

Restoring Dural Excursions and Alleviating Extremity Paresthesia

In lumbar and cervical disc disorders, inflammatory compression provokes intraneural edema and dural adhesions that impair physiological nerve gliding through anatomical tunnels.

Our clinicians deploy precise neurodynamic sliders and tensioners: 1. Sciatic Nerve Mobilization: Alternating ankle dorsiflexion and knee extension with cervical motion to facilitate smooth axonal gliding without excessive tensile strain. 2. Median and Radial Nerve Glides: Decompressing upper extremity neural pathways to resolve cervicobrachial tingling and restoring uninhibited arm elevation. 3. Accelerating Intraneural Edema Resorption: Promoting capillary microcirculation around irritated dural sleeves, expediting symptom resolution.

Ergonomic Optimization of Home and Work Environments

Modifying Seating, Bedding, and Daily Movement to Prevent Recurrent Strain

Our therapist audits your living and remote work environment within Eastern Province homes: - Ergonomic adjustment of home office chairs, lumbar supports, and computer monitor heights to preserve neutral cervical and lumbar lordosis. - Evaluating mattress firmness and pillow contouring to eliminate asymmetrical nocturnal spinal stress. - Educating patients on proper hip-hinging body mechanics when lifting household items or performing daily chores to safeguard lumbar intervertebral discs.

Functional Movement and Prayer Ergonomics Retraining

Conditioning Lower Extremity Joints for Safe Ground Prayer Postures

In Saudi domestic life, independent ground prayer (Sujood and Ruku) represents an essential functional milestone for rehabilitation candidates: - Progressive Closed-Chain Loading: Retraining quadriceps eccentric control and hip flexion tolerance to facilitate controlled lowering to floor mats without traumatic joint impact. - Ankle and Knee Capsular Flexibility: Deploying specialized soft-tissue mobilizations to restore end-range plantarflexion and knee flexion required for seated prayer. - Ergonomic Chair Alternatives: For patients with severe joint contractures, establishing supportive chair prayer postures that maintain dignity while preventing harmful spinal torque.

Knee Osteoarthritis and Joint Unloading Protocols in the Domestic Setting

Mitigating Compartmental Joint Compression and Isolating the Vastus Medialis Oblique (VMO)

Knee osteoarthritis is highly prevalent among older adults and middle-aged individuals across the Eastern Province. Our in-home physical therapy protocols focus on eliminating abnormal compressive and shear forces across the tibiofemoral and patellofemoral joints: - Patellofemoral Glide Mobilizations: Restoring superior, inferior, and medial patellar accessory mobility to ensure smooth trochlear tracking during flexion and extension cycles. - Vastus Medialis Oblique (VMO) Neuromuscular Activation: Deploying terminal knee extension drills over foam rollers, utilizing portable neuromuscular electrical stimulation (NMES) when arthrogenic muscle inhibition is present. - Hip Abductor and External Rotator Strengthening: Targeted closed-chain clamshells and lateral resistance-band walks to control the dynamic Q-angle, preventing dynamic knee valgus during stair climbing and sit-to-stand transitions.

Adhesive Capsulitis (Frozen Shoulder) and Rotator Cuff In-Home Protocols

Staged Capsular Distension, Maitland Inferior Glides, and Scapulohumeral Rhythm Restoration

Managing adhesive capsulitis and rotator cuff tendinopathy inside the home demands stage-specific clinical pacing to avoid exacerbating chronic synovitits: - Freezing Stage Management: Emphasizing gentle pain-free pendular movements, Grade I-II glenohumeral oscillations, and scapular retraction exercises to preserve periscapular muscular tone without provoking nocturnal pain. - Frozen Stage Mobilization: Deploying Grade III-IV Maitland inferior and posterior humeral glides to stretch the contracted inferior axillary pouch, systematically reclaiming external rotation and abduction. - Thawing and Functional Strengthening: Progressing into active-assisted pulley exercises, eccentric rotator cuff loading with graduated elastic tubing, and retraining kinetic chain force couples between the serratus anterior and lower trapezius.

Clinical Safety Boundaries and Urgent Emergency Exclusion

Strict Protocols Protecting Patients from Severe Neurological Complications

If any of the following clinical red flags are detected during spinal evaluation: 1. Sudden loss of bowel or bladder control, or saddle numbness in the perineal region (Cauda Equina Syndrome). 2. Acute progressive motor paresis such as sudden foot drop or severe quadriceps buckle during weight bearing. 3. Unremitting severe nocturnal back pain unaffected by posture, accompanied by systemic fever or rapid unexplained weight loss. Therapy is halted immediately, and the patient is referred for urgent neurosurgical or emergency hospital evaluation (997).
